#31747e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#31747e is composed of 19.2% red, 45.5%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.1% cyan, 7.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 187.8 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 34.3%. #31747e color hex could be obtained by blending #62e8f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#31747e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c0d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#31747e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535b5c is the less saturated color, while #0297ad is the most saturated one.
